Design and Build Quality
The iPad Pro M2 11 features a sleek, minimalist design with a durable aluminum chassis, weighing approximately 466 grams. Its compact size makes it highly portable, ideal for on-the-go professionals. The Galaxy Tab S8 Ultra, on the other hand, boasts a larger 14.6-inch AMOLED display housed in a premium metal frame, weighing around 726 grams. While slightly heavier, its expansive screen offers a better experience for multitasking and creative work.
Performance and Power
The iPad Pro M2 is powered by Apple’s M2 chip, which delivers exceptional performance for demanding tasks such as video editing, 3D modeling, and multitasking. It features up to 16GB of RAM and fast SSD storage options. The Galaxy Tab S8 Ultra is equipped with the Qualcomm Snapdragon 8 Gen 1 processor, coupled with up to 16GB of RAM. While both devices are powerful, the M2 chip generally outperforms the Snapdragon in raw processing power, especially for creative applications optimized for iOS.
Display and Visual Experience
The Galaxy Tab S8 Ultra’s 14.6-inch AMOLED display offers vibrant colors, deep blacks, and a high refresh rate of 120Hz, making it ideal for multimedia and detailed creative work. The iPad Pro M2 features a 11-inch Liquid Retina display with ProMotion technology, also supporting a 120Hz refresh rate. While smaller, the iPad’s display is known for its color accuracy and sharpness, perfect for professional photography and design work.

Battery Life and Efficiency
Both tablets offer impressive battery life, with the iPad Pro M2 typically lasting around 10 hours of mixed usage. The Galaxy Tab S8 Ultra’s larger battery capacity provides similar endurance, often exceeding 12 hours under moderate use. Efficiency varies based on workload; the M2 chip’s optimization for iOS generally results in better power management during intensive tasks.
Accessories and Productivity Features
Apple’s Magic Keyboard and Apple Pencil (2nd generation) enhance the iPad Pro’s productivity, offering a laptop-like experience. The Galaxy Tab S8 Ultra supports the S Pen included in the box and offers keyboard accessories from Samsung, facilitating multitasking and creative workflows. Both ecosystems provide versatile tools for professionals.
